summaryrefslogtreecommitdiff
Commit message (Collapse)AuthorAgeFilesLines
* dev-lang/go: sync 1.13.6 with liveWilliam Hubbs2020-01-231-9/+0
| | | | | | | | | | | | | | | | | | | | | | | This syncs the following build-time changes from the live ebuild: - use dev-lang/go-bootstrap to bootstrap the initial installation. This means that we will only download the relevant bootstrap archive. go-bootstrap can be depcleaned after the initial go installation. - use go itself to bootstrap if it is already installed. This means go-bootstrap will not be downloaded as long as go is on the system. - Drop the gccgo and system-bootstrap use flags. Bootstrapping go with gccgo had several issues, and it is no longer needed. Also, the system-bootstrap use flag is no longer needed since this behavior is the default if go is installed. closes: https://bugs.gentoo.org/618794 closes: https://bugs.gentoo.org/664048 closes: https://bugs.gentoo.org/684652 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: fix manifestWilliam Hubbs2020-01-231-2/+0
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: fix manifestWilliam Hubbs2020-01-221-4/+4
| | | | | | closes: https://bugs.gentoo.org/706110 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go-1.13.6: new bootstrap binaries to allow build on muslWilliam Hubbs2020-01-211-0/+9
| | | | | | | closes: https://bugs.gentoo.org/576290 closes: https://bugs.gentoo.org/606970 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.15 bumpWilliam Hubbs2020-01-121-0/+1
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.13.6 bumpWilliam Hubbs2020-01-121-0/+1
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.14 bumpWilliam Hubbs2019-12-141-0/+1
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.13.5 bumpWilliam Hubbs2019-12-141-0/+1
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ove unstable versionsWilliam Hubbs2019-11-241-4/+0
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ove old 1.13 versionsWilliam Hubbs2019-11-231-4/+0
| | | |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.13 and 1.13.4 bumpWilliam Hubbs2019-11-031-0/+2
| | | | | Package-Manager: Portage-2.3.76,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.12 and 1.13.3 bumpWilliam Hubbs2019-10-181-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.76,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.11 and 1.13.2 bumpWilliam Hubbs2019-10-171-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.76,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.10 and 1.13.1 bumpWilliam Hubbs2019-09-261-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ove old versionWilliam Hubbs2019-09-181-1/+0
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ove old 1.12 versionsWilliam Hubbs2019-09-061-3/+0
| | | | | | | | | All 1.11 versions are removed since that version is no longer supported upstream. Bug: https://bugs.gentoo.org/692152 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ove 1.11William Hubbs2019-09-061-3/+0
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.13 bumpWilliam Hubbs2019-09-031-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.9 bumpWilliam Hubbs2019-08-201-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.13 and 1.12.8 security bumpWilliam Hubbs2019-08-141-0/+2
| | | | | | | | Bug: https://bugs.gentoo.org/692152 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.69, Repoman-2.3.16 RepoMan-Options: --force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.12 and 1.12.7 bumpWilliam Hubbs2019-07-101-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.6 bumpWilliam Hubbs2019-07-071-0/+1
| | | | | Package-Manager: Portage-2.3.66,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ove old versionsWilliam Hubbs2019-05-271-8/+0
| | | | | Package-Manager: Portage-2.3.66,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.5 and 1.11.10 bumpWilliam Hubbs2019-05-071-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.9 and 1.12.4 bumpWilliam Hubbs2019-04-151-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.8 and 1.12.3 bumpWilliam Hubbs2019-04-101-0/+2
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.7 and 1.12.2 bumpWilliam Hubbs2019-04-061-0/+2
| | | | |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: add non-vulnerable version of go 1.11William Hubbs2019-04-021-0/+1
| | | | | | | | | | This would have gone stable with 1.12.1 if I had known of its existance so I think we can go straight to stable.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.62, Repoman-2.3.12 RepoMan-Options: --force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ove vulnerable version 1.11.5William Hubbs2019-03-311-1/+0
| | | | | | Bug: https://bugs.gentoo.org/680240 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ove unstable versionWilliam Hubbs2019-03-201-1/+0
| | | | |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.12.1 bump and cross compile fixWilliam Hubbs2019-03-161-0/+1
| | | | | | | | | | | | | | | | | | | | | dev-lang/go, before this commit, failed to build in an environment generated by sys-devel/crossdev for two reasons: 1. The bootstrap download package matched the target rather than host arch. We can't determine the host arch based on use flags, so we need to download all bootstrap packages. 2. The GOROOT_BOOTSTRAP environment variable matched the host rather than target arch. To fix this, we need to pass CBUILD to the calls to go_os and go_arch. This fixes both issues for a successful cross-compile. Closes: https://bugs.gentoo.org/671394 Package-Manager: Portage-2.3.62,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ove go 1.10William Hubbs2019-02-261-1/+0
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: go 1.12 version bumpWilliam Hubbs2019-02-261-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ove vulnerable versionsWilliam Hubbs2019-02-011-2/+0
| | | | | | bug: https://bugs.gentoo.org/676368 Package-Manager: Portage-2.3.59,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.10.8 and 1.11.5 security bumpsWilliam Hubbs2019-01-241-0/+2
| | | | | | | | | | This is going directly to stable on amd64. Bug: https://github.com/golang/go/issues/29903 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.56, Repoman-2.3.12 RepoMan-Options: --force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: Security cleanupMikle Kolyada2018-12-201-2/+0
| | | | | Signed-off-by: Mikle Kolyada <zlogene@gentoo.org> Package-Manager: Portage-2.3.51, Repoman-2.3.11
* dev-lang/go: remove multiple unstable versionsWilliam Hubbs2018-12-191-6/+0
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.10.7 bumpWilliam Hubbs2018-12-171-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.10.6 bumpWilliam Hubbs2018-12-171-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.4 bumpWilliam Hubbs2018-12-171-0/+1
| | | | | | Copyright: Sony Interactive Entertainment Inc. Package-Manager: Portage-2.3.51, Repoman-2.3.12 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.10.5 bumpWilliam Hubbs2018-11-081-0/+1
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.2 bumpWilliam Hubbs2018-11-081-0/+1
| | | | | Package-Manager: Portage-2.3.51,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ove 1.9William Hubbs2018-11-021-2/+0
| | | | | Package-Manager: Portage-2.3.49,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: remove unstable 1.10 releaseWilliam Hubbs2018-11-021-1/+0
| | | | | Package-Manager: Portage-2.3.49,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.10.4 version bumpWilliam Hubbs2018-10-241-0/+1
| | | | | | closes: https://bugs.gentoo.org/show_bug.cgi?id=668874 Package-Manager: Portage-2.3.49,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11.1 version bumpWilliam Hubbs2018-10-211-0/+1
| | | | | Package-Manager: Portage-2.3.49, Repoman-2.3.11 Signed-off-by: William Hubbs <williamh@gentoo.org>
* dev-lang/go: 1.11 version bumpWilliam Hubbs2018-09-061-0/+1
| | | | Package-Manager: Portage-2.3.40, Repoman-2.3.9
* dev-lang/go: 1.9.7 bumpWilliam Hubbs2018-06-241-0/+1
| | | | | Closes: https://bugs.gentoo.org/658012 Package-Manager: Portage-2.3.40, Repoman-2.3.9
* dev-lang/go: Bump to 1.10.3Nelo-T. Wallus2018-06-241-0/+1
| | | | | | | Bug: https://bugs.gentoo.org/658012 Closes: https://github.com/gentoo/gentoo/pull/8852 Package-Manager: Portage-2.3.40, Repoman-2.3.9
* dev-lang/go: 1.9.6 version bumpWilliam Hubbs2018-05-141-0/+1
| | | | | | | | | It was pointed out to me that upstream supports the two most recent major releases, so we will attempt to do the same in Gentoo. https://golang.org/doc/devel/release.html#policy Package-Manager: Portage-2.3.24, Repoman-2.3.6